`N_2` forms `NCI_3` whereas P can form both `PCl_3` and `PCl_5`. Why?

A

P has dorbitals which can be used for bonding but `N_2` does not have d orbitals

B

N atom is larger than P in size

C

P is more reactive towards Cl than N

D

The size of N is comparable to Cl while P size is greater than that of CI

Text Solution

Verified by Experts

The correct Answer is:
A

P has emply d orbitals which can be used for bonding whereas `N_2` does not have d orbitals.
